Hurricane Harvey has made a second landfall in Louisiana, five days after slamming into Texas.

Harvey made a second landfall on Wednesday, hitting Louisiana, a state which still bears deep scars from 2005's Hurricane Katrina.

The monster storm Harvey hit the south Texas coast  and then stalled, gushing torrents of rain over Houston. 

There are at least four reported deaths so far, with six more deaths potentially tied to the storm while thousands have been left homeless and in need to stay in emergency shelters.

The region experienced winds nearing 72 kilometers per hour, with forecasters predicting another 13 to 25 centimeters of rain that could pour on the region.

The storm will gradually weaken to a tropical depression.
